Transaction 64d1d63c2aa302694391ffce448d0a9c7f45cc4f4a6a0a481e770dec2623f524

1 Input
2 Outputs
  • 64d1d63c2aa302694391ffce448d0a9c7f45cc4f4a6a0a481e770dec2623f524:0
  • value  253262
    address  1HffmFrrRKYBa6rdZCEQUWvzTyY2bh3Bh6
  • 64d1d63c2aa302694391ffce448d0a9c7f45cc4f4a6a0a481e770dec2623f524:1
  • value  159309162
    address  1KHwtS5mn7NMUm7Ls7Y1XwxLqMriLdaGbX